# Possible Acquisition: Tellhurst Fabrication

*Restricted: managers only*

Heads up, branch managers — leadership is in early talks to acquire Tellhurst Fabrication, a mid-size shop out of Brindleton. Nothing is signed, so keep this off the floor. If it goes through, we'd fold their tooling line into our Ridgeway operation. Expect a Q&A call once terms firm up. For context, here's the current thinking on direction.

board note of bagaf-haduf: The renewal with Druathek Holdings closes at $10 million a year, 5 percent below the last contract. Project Zorath slips by six weeks because of the staffing delay.

Step 4 of the Wheelwright migration: we're moving the rebalancing scheduler off the old Pedalmatic cron box and onto the Spokeline workers. Before you approve this, double-check that the dock-occupancy snapshots land in the new schema — the reviewer last time missed a stale trigger and we double-counted bikes in Harrow Bend for a week. Run the backfill script once against staging first. It expects the target database specified via the line below.

primary connection of yagep-kahip = redis://giliel_svc:zYiKsLL2PLpfPL@db-348f.xolmarsys.corp:5432/fenwyn

TICKET: TRC-2281 — Signature verification failing on trace collector

The Lanternpath trace collector is rejecting spans forwarded from the checkout and inventory services. Verification fails because those services still sign trace batches with the key retired in last week's rotation. Impact: cross-service request traces are incomplete for roughly 14% of traffic. Fix is to redeploy both services with the current signing key baked into their config bundles. Rollback is not required. For convenience, the current signing key is included below.

deploy key for tahof-yadup: bky6_JWeaJq

Quick recap for the finance team: the proposed training budget lands about 12% above this year, driven mainly by the Lanthorn certification push and onboarding for the new Quillbrook office. Tomas pushed back on the external-vendor line, so expect a revised figure before sign-off. Department allocations stay roughly flat otherwise, with a small contingency pot held centrally. Worth noting the budget assumes headcount growth that isn't yet confirmed. The strategic context sits in the confidential note below.

confidential, kagep-kahof: Druokax Systems plans to lower the Ulaath list price by 53 percent in March.